Slate roof leak repair services involve identifying and addressing leaks that occur in slate roofing systems. Skilled contractors typically perform a thorough inspection to locate areas where water may be penetrating the roof, such as damaged or missing slates, cracked tiles, or compromised flashing. Once the problem areas are identified, repairs may include replacing damaged slates, sealing cracks, or installing new flashing components to prevent future leaks. The goal is to restore the roof’s integrity and prevent water from infiltrating the building’s interior, which can cause further damage to the structure and interior finishes.

These services help solve common roofing issues associated with slate materials, such as water intrusion,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Leaks in slate roofs can lead to significant problems if left unaddressed, including rotted roof decks, stained ceilings, and compromised insulation. Repairing leaks promptly can also extend the lifespan of the existing slate roof, avoiding the need for costly full replacements. Proper leak repair ensures that the roof remains weather-tight, protecting the property’s interior from water damage and the potential for mold or mildew development.

Material Replacement Costs - Replacing damaged slate tiles typically ranges from $1,000 to $4,000 for a standard section. The cost varies based on the size of the area and tile quality, with larger repairs increasing expenses.

Leak Detection Expenses - Identifying the source of a roof leak can cost between $150 and $500, depending on the complexity of the inspection. More extensive assessments may require additional services, affecting the overall price.

Repair Service Fees - Repairing leaks in slate roofs generally falls within the $300 to $1,200 range per incident. Costs depend on the extent of damage and whether partial or full repairs are necessary.

Additional Costs - Emergency or urgent repair services may incur extra charges, typically ranging from $200 to $600. These costs reflect the need for expedited work or after-hours service by local professionals.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How can I tell if my slate roof is leaking? Signs of a leak may include water stains on ceilings or walls, visible moisture, or damaged/slipped slate tiles. An inspection by a local roofing professional can help identify issues early.

What causes slate roof leaks? Leaks can result from cracked or broken slate tiles, damaged flashing, or deteriorated underlayment, often due to weathering or age-related wear.

Are repairs on slate roofs complex? Yes, repairing a slate roof requires specialized knowledge to replace or repair individual tiles without damaging the surrounding material. It is recommended to work with experienced local contractors.

How long do slate roof leak repairs typically last? The longevity of repairs depends on the extent of damage and quality of work, but properly performed repairs can extend the roof's lifespan and prevent future leaks.

How can I prevent future leaks on my slate roof? Regular inspections, timely repairs of damaged tiles, and maintenance of flashing and underlayment can help minimize the risk of future leaks.
